Twice this year, I've read books that use "skeleton key" to mean any old-fashioned key (I think the technical name for those old-school locks is a ward lock). Is this a mistake or a new usage? When I was a kid, skeleton key meant a key cut down to the bare minimum dimensions so it could open many locks, basically a lockpicking device (or, occasionally, a master key) #AmWritng @grammargirl

I'm an old UNIX/Linux geek. I write everything using LaTex:
\usepackage{fancyhdr}
\setlength{\headheight}{15pt}
\pagestyle{fancy}\renewcommand{\chaptermark}[1]{ \markboth{#1}{} }
\fancyhf{}
\fancyhf[HLE,HRO]{The Measurement Problem}
\fancyhf[HRE,HLO]{\leftmark}
\fancyhf[FLE,FRO]{\thepage} -
